How do you simplify radicals?
Look for roots within the radical:
√162 = √(81*2) = 9√2
Simplify:
√(80x7)
√(80x7)
√(16*5*x6*x)
= 4x³√(5x)

What is rationalizing the denominator?
Taking the radical out fo the denominator.
Rationalize
√2/√x
Multiply by √x/√x
= √(2x)/x
How do you add and subtract radicals if the radicals are the same?
Just add:
3√2 + 5√2 = 8√2
[Just as 3*2 + 4*2 = 7*2]
What if the radicals are not the same?
Try to make them the same.
Solve:
11√3 - √12
11√3 - √12
= 11√3 - 2√3
= 9√3

Solve:
3x = 2x + √(4x + 5)
3x = 2x + √(4x + 5)
x = √(4x + 5)
x² = 4x + 5
Quadratic equation:
x² - 4x - 5 = 0
(x - 5)(x + 1)
x = 5 or -1
Check. -1 is an extraneous solution
Solve:
8 + √(4y) = 4
8 + √(4y) = 4
√(4y) = -4
No solution.
The square root of 16 is not -4

What is the domain of √x?
Positive numbers
What is the domain of √(x - 3)?
All positive numbers ≥ 3
Compare the graphs of
y = √x and
y = √(x - 3)
y = √(x - 3) is the graph of
y = √x moved 3 to the right.
How does the graph of
y = √x + 4 compare to
the graph of √x?
It is moved up the y-axis 4.
